The Max Planck Institute for Plasma Physics (IPP) is one of the world's leading centers for fusion research. With around 1100 dedicated employees in Garching near Munich and Greifswald, we are committed to exploring the fundamental principles of fusion power plants. These power plants generate energy without climate-damaging emissions, are safe, sustainable and nearly limitless – just like the sun. Fusion power plants have the potential to play an important role in supplying energy to future generations.

At the IPP site in Greifswald, we are conducting research on the large-scale experiment Wendelstein 7-X. This fusion plant is the world's largest stellarator type.

The Max Planck Institute for Plasma Physics (IPP), with sites in Garching and Greifswald, is a global leader in fusion research, dedicated to advancing magnetic confinement as a sustainable energy source. The Greifswald site hosts Wendelstein 7-X (short W7-X), the world’s largest superconducting stellarator and a flagship facility for optimized stellarator physics. W7-X enables stable, high-performance plasma operation – critical for advancing understanding in confinement, transport, stability, plasma-wall interactions, heating, control, and diagnostics.
